How does Allensville, PA compare to Orangeville, PA? Allensville has a population of 413 with a median household income of $70,391, while Orangeville has 414 residents and a median income of $61,964.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Allensville, PA | Orangeville, PA |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 413 | 414 | -0.2% |
| Median Age | 32.8 | 59.7 | -45.1% |
| Foreign Born % | 5.3% | 0% | +530.0% |
| Metric | Allensville | Orangeville |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$70,391 | $61,964 | +13.6% |
| Unemployment | 2.7% | 3.6% | -25.0% |
| Poverty Rate | 10.4% | 3.9% | +166.7% |
| Bachelor's+ | 6.6% | 15.9% | -58.5% |
| Metric | Allensville | Orangeville |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$147,700 | $181,500 | -18.6% |
| Median Rent | $750/mo | $950/mo | -21.1% |
| Housing Units | 150 | 126 | +19.0% |
